Overview of Flash Media Server

Flash Media Server provides you with streaming media capabilities and a powerful, flexible development environment. This enables you to create and deliver a wide range of interactive media applications. Use Flash Media Server to create traditional media delivery applications such as video-on-demand, live web event broadcasts, or MP3 streaming. You can also design communication applications like video blogging, video messaging, and multimedia chat environments. Flash Media Server is part of Macromedia's complete solution for database connectivity, directory systems, and presence services, and is the only server that can deliver audio and video to the popular Flash Player.
